ABOUT THE HAURAKI DISTRICT
The Hauraki District is situated at the base of the Coromandel Peninsula and covers the Hauraki Plains, Paeroa, Waihi and Whiritoa area. There is a very diverse range of geographics and communities. Ngatea, is the hub of the Hauraki Plains, which is predominantly one of the best dairy farming areas in the country. Originally a thriving port, Paeroa is now world famous for the “ Big L & P Bottle" – a reminder of the therapeutic spring waters of Paeroa. Waihi is the town with the heart of gold. It was a thriving goldmining community at the turn of the 19th century and today there is still the large working open-cast mine in Waihi. Whiritoa is a popular summer holiday destination with a great east-coast surf beach.
1. You can visit the beautiful Karangahake Gorge with the Ohinemuri and Waitawheta Rivers flowing through it and walk the many walkways and tunnels, discovering the old gold mining sites among native bush.
2. Waihi is the town with a heart of gold and many fantastic sporting facilities, including an events centre. Lovely Waihi Beach and Whiritoa Beach are just a stone’s throw away.
3. The three golf courses in the district are all well maintained and very popular with locals and visitors. A great way to spend the weekend. Courses are situated in Waihi, Paeroa and Mangatarata.
4. The Hugh Hayward Domain in Ngatea has one of the finest hockey complexes in the country. The full sized sand turf is the focal point of the domain, which also features facilities for many other sports plus a swimming pool and hall. Across the road is the world class Ngatea Water Gardens. Walk through the gardens with its many unique water features.
5. The Miranda Oasis Springs feature the largest natural hot water pool in the southern hemisphere. There are private and public saunas, kids pool and fantastic barbeque areas for the complete family day out. The pool complex also has a caravan park and new tourist cabins.
6. You can come and try out the new indoor skating and leisure centre in Paeroa. Skate hireage is available. When finished here – try your hand at waterskiing, kayaking or boating on the Waihou River down at Cooks Cut.
